"Do You Want to Build a Snowman?" is a song from the 2013 Disney animated feature film Frozen, with music and lyrics composed by Kristen Anderson-Lopez and Robert Lopez. The song is performed in the film by Kristen Bell, Agatha Lee Monn, and Katie Lopez, each playing the role of Princess Anna at different ages. It occurs near the beginning of the film when Elsa has been locked away in her room because her parents are afraid of her losing control of her powers and hurting Anna. As the girls grow older together, they are kept apart.
